Just wondering if anyone had a schematic for a punch out PCB that would point location and workings for the "color roms"

Example: Chip 6E = Upper monitor RED

trying to diagnose a PCB color issue. Figured if i could switch chips from upper to lower monitor I would be able to figure out WHAT PROM (*if any) was the problem

thanks in advance..
 
You can tell if you look really close at the board. I did it once, just write down where the wires come in from the harness, and follow them back carefully they get to the proms pretty quick, so you can tell which one controls which one.

BTW, I had about 3 of those boards that had color issues and it was always either a bad connection on the edge connector, or the color proms.
